Leland Howard and the Bureau of Entomology

Leland Howard, he was the chief of the Bureau of Entomology for quite some time. His interest included medical entomology as well as biological control. It was under his tenure that the USDA extended and expanded its powers. White agriculturalists saw him as a threat to their business.
